Bloomington (Monroe County, Indiana) World Courier, May 30, 1913, pg. 1, late edition.

DEATH OF MRS. WM. BRANAMAN

Mrs. Amanda Branaman, 36 years old and wife of William Branaman, nine miles southeast of the city, died at one o'clock this morning of acute Bright's disease. She was the daughter of Simpson Blackwell of Polk township. Mrs. Branaman is survived by her husband and five small children, the oldest being 11 and the youngest only eight months old. The names of the children are: Augusta, Gladys, Fatha, Anna and Hattie.

Funeral at one o'clock tomorrow at the Todd cemetery in charge of Elder Monroe Swindler.
